The Impact of Microorganisms on Us:
Microorganisms play a vital role in nutrient cycling, breaking down organic matter and recycling essential elements like nitrogen and phosphorus.
They contribute to the breakdown of pollutants, contributing to environmental purification and pollution mitigation.
Microorganisms are essential for the functioning of ecosystems, impacting weather patterns, controlling pests, and influencing species interactions.
Some microorganisms, like extremophiles, can withstand extreme environmental conditions, highlighting their remarkable resilience and adaptability.
Understanding the Microbiome: A Complex Ecosystem:
The human body is home to trillions of microorganisms, forming a complex and diverse microbial ecosystem.
Each individual carries trillions of microbes, each with specific functions and interactions within this ecosystem.
The microbiome plays a crucial role in human health, participating in immune function, regulating metabolism, and influencing mental and emotional well-being.
Maintaining a healthy microbiome is essential for overall health and preventing various diseases.
